Mutual Non-Disclosure Agreement Spanish

A mutual non-disclosure agreement, or NDA, is a legal contract between two parties that outlines the confidential information they wish to share with each other. This document is designed to protect the interests of both parties by ensuring that any sensitive information exchanged between them is kept private.

If you are doing business with Spanish-speaking parties, it is essential to have a mutual non-disclosure agreement in place in Spanish. This agreement will help to prevent any potential language barriers and ensure that both parties fully understand the terms of the agreement.

The purpose of a mutual non-disclosure agreement Spanish is to ensure that both parties agree to keep the information they share confidential, and to restrict any unauthorized use or disclosure of that information. This agreement can be used in a wide range of settings, such as business negotiations, partnerships, collaborations, and other contexts where confidential information is shared.

When entering into a mutual non-disclosure agreement in Spanish, it is important to clearly define what constitutes confidential information and how it can be used. Any information that is considered confidential should be explicitly stated in the agreement, along with any limitations or restrictions on its use.

Additionally, the agreement should outline how long the information will be considered confidential, and what happens if the confidentiality agreement is breached. This can include legal remedies, such as monetary damages or an injunction prohibiting further disclosure of the confidential information.

To ensure that a mutual non-disclosure agreement Spanish is legally binding and effective, it is important to consult with a qualified attorney who has experience in this area. An attorney can review the terms of the agreement and help to ensure that it meets the legal requirements for enforceability in both parties’ jurisdictions.
